Water naturally moves across properties following low areas, swales, and drainage paths that often cross where driveways or access roads need to be built. Installing a culvert allows that water to continue flowing beneath the roadway without pooling, washing out the surface, or blocking access. Bradway Land Management places culverts at locations where runoff, seasonal streams, or drainage ditches intersect with planned or existing access routes, creating a functional crossing that maintains both vehicle passage and water movement.


The installation involves excavating a trench across the driveway path, placing the culvert pipe at the correct depth and angle to match the natural water flow, and backfilling around the pipe with compacted material that supports the weight of vehicles. The surrounding grade is shaped to direct water into the culvert inlet and allow it to exit downstream without erosion or backup.

How Culvert Work Supports Access and Drainage

Culvert size depends on the volume of water expected to pass through during rain events, with diameter and length chosen based on the width of the driveway and the slope of the surrounding terrain. The pipe is positioned so water enters smoothly, flows through without obstruction, and exits at a grade that prevents scouring or sediment buildup. Proper backfill and compaction around the culvert prevent settling that could cause the driveway surface to sink or crack over time.


Once the culvert is installed and the driveway surface is graded, water will flow beneath the access route during rain rather than pooling on top or washing across the roadway. The driveway remains passable in wet conditions, and the natural drainage pattern continues downstream without interruption or erosion at the crossing point.


Culvert installation does not include driveway surfacing with gravel or asphalt, though the surrounding grade is prepared to support those materials if added later. The focus is on establishing a stable crossing that handles water flow and vehicle weight without compromising either function.

Answers to Frequent Service Questions

Property owners in Osceola and neighboring communities often ask practical questions about culvert work before installing a new driveway or improving an existing access route.

  • What determines the size of the culvert pipe?

    The pipe diameter is selected based on the amount of water flowing through the area during heavy rain, the slope of the land, and the width of the driveway that needs to pass over it.

  • How deep is the culvert installed?

    Depth depends on the natural grade of the drainage path and the height of the planned driveway surface, with the pipe positioned to maintain water flow while providing adequate cover for vehicle traffic above.

  • What happens to water during and immediately after installation?

    Water is temporarily redirected or allowed to flow around the work area during excavation, then resumes its normal path through the culvert once the pipe is placed and backfill is compacted.

  • Can a culvert be installed where water only flows occasionally?

    Yes, seasonal or intermittent water flow still requires a culvert if the drainage path crosses the driveway, since even occasional runoff can wash out an access route without proper passage beneath it.

  • What material is used for backfill around the culvert?

    Compacted gravel or soil is placed around and over the pipe to distribute vehicle weight, prevent shifting, and maintain the driveway's structural integrity across the culvert location.
